Tuohy Family From 'The Blind Side' Writes Book About Inspiring Story

The real life Tuohy family, who took in young Michael Oher and supported him until he was selected in the first round of the NFL draft by the Baltimore Ravens, and featured in the box-office smash "The Blindside," has now written a book about their experiences. It's titled, "In A Heartbeat."

George Stephanopoulos from ABC News spoke to Leigh Anne and Sean Tuohy and what inspired them to help out.

"It's great to write a check," Leigh Anne Tuohy said. "But it's more important to give of your time and of yourself and of your talents. That's what makes a difference."

When asked why their story touched so many people, Sean Tuohy said that the gap between where Oher was and where he is now was so great. "You couldn't have been further down than he was," he said. "And you couldn't be higher up than he is now."
